D-Erythrose 4-phosphate sodium
Also known as sodium [(2R,3R)-2,3-dihydroxy-4-oxobutyl] hydrogen phosphate
D-Erythrose 4-phosphate sodium is the sodium phosphate salt of the monosaccharide erythrose, an intermediate in the pentose phosphate pathway and the Calvin cycle· D-Erythrose 4-phosphate sodium can be used as a substrate to identify, differentiate and characterize various synthases that initiate the shikimate pathway in microorganisms and plants
